Local Teen represented USA at IAAF World Youth Track Championships

San Lorenzo Valley High school student Anna Maxwell has had an action-packed track season this year. Maxwell just finished her junior year and has been busy making headlines after every race. To cap her season off, she placed ninth at the IAAF World Youth Championships in Donetsk, Ukraine on Saturday July 13th. With a time of 4 minutes, 23.75 seconds she ran the 1500 meters to set another personal best.
San Lorenzo Valley Coach Rob Collins and Santa Cruz Running Company Sales Associate couldn’t be more proud of his rising superstar. She was one of 2 Americans to represent USA and proudly wear the uniform.  “Anna is a great runner, this is something she will remember the rest of her life” said Coach Collins.
Her 2013 Season stacked up like this:

  • At CCS finals she place 1st in 1600m 4:42.57 & 1st in 3200M – 10:22
  • She won the 1600 at the State CIF Championships
  • Finished 2nd running the 1500 at youth field trials in Illinois – 425.93 this time advanced her to the IAAF World Youth Championships in Ukraine.
  • Was named by Santa Cruz Sentinel, Girls Athlete of the year.
  • Place Ninth at IAAFF World Youth Championship race wearing red, white & blue.
